But when you actually look at what’s happening, the explanation is far less dramatic. Drooling during sleep is usually linked to how your body relaxes, especially your facial muscles and swallowing reflex. When you’re in a deep, relaxed state—particularly if you’re sleeping on your side or stomach—saliva can naturally escape instead of being swallowed. It’s not a secret signal or a special brain condition—it’s just your body fully unwinding.

There are also simple factors that can increase it, like nasal congestion, sleep position, or even just being extra tired. In many cases, it can actually suggest that you’ve reached a deeper stage of sleep, where your body is more relaxed than usual. That’s not something to worry about—it’s something most people experience at some point without even noticing until it’s pointed out.
